I'm wondering if it is possible to bind the default frame buffer's depth as a texture so that it can be sampled from in a fragment shader (during rendering passes which do not write to that depth buffer)? If so, some pointers would be appreciated.
sample depth from default frame buffer? (GL ES 3)
438 views Asked by user8709 At
1
There are 1 answers
Related Questions in OPENGL-ES
- How can I use ARCore and OpenGL without Sceneform for making ar measurement app android?
- Unable to find GL_INT_2_10_10_10_REV define on Android GLES
- How to rotate model and view matrix with same angle?
- CameraX custom OpenGL Video Pipeline (`UseCase`/`VideoOutput`)
- How do I avoid leaking Graphics memory in OpenGL ES 2.0 in a background thread on Android?
- How to Create GPU SkImage in a Background Thread and Draw it on a Main SkSurface with OpenGL and Skia?
- glTexSubImage2D throws GL_INVALID_OPERATION in OpenGL ES 3.2 on Android NDK with FreeType
- What are the rules for the precision of casting operations in GLSL
- Why would a OpenGL ES 2.0 leak graphics memory on Android, but not iOS with the same code
- Create a VideoFrame from Canvas
- GLES30 Ray Picking gluUnProject
- OpenGL lighting works incorrectly on Android and WebAssembly
- WebGL: this extension has very low support on mobile devices
- OpenGL ES 3.0 - Textures black
- OpenGL-glGetUniformLocation failed
Related Questions in OPENGL-ES-3.0
- GLES30 Ray Picking gluUnProject
- OpenGL ES 3.0 - Textures black
- Change camera view for RENDERBUFFER but not for main render view
- How does this code work with multiple buffer bound to same target?
- I'm having a problem with the stuff in my Godot mobile game
- How to create sphere without indices?
- Is it faster to use multiple shader programs or a single program with uniform uploads in OpenGL ES 3.0?
- Want to store info in the alpha channel but NOT have it blend the pixel
- How to draw a point in OpenGL ES3
- shader not getting compiled in Chrome OS, openglES 3.0
- Draw nothing for an OpenGL ES 3 + SDL2 + ANGLE + MSVC
- Alternative to Geometric Shader in OpenGL ES 3.0
- How to destroy the OpenGL context clearly
- How to create texture with 16bit depth one component in OpenGL ES3.0 on Android?
- Converting shaders to opengles 3.0
Related Questions in OPENGL-ES-3.1
- imageStore causing crash in GL ES 3.1 Compute shader using ANGLE on windows
- in/out to Fragment Shader from Geometry Shader using GLES31 (#version 310 es)
- Is there a way to determine GPU warp/wavefront/SIMD width on Android?
- Why Compute Shader is slowing down the rendering API calls?
- glTexImage2D texture is not available for read in right format
- what is the maximum integer(unsigned integer) value that glsl can support?
- Android How to split camera stream into several streams with different fps/resolution/water_marks for preview/record/Live Stream/AI
- Why is my triangle white in OpenGL ES 3 on Raspberry Pi
- use glsl modulo with uint
- Color using alpha blending are different on different Android phones with OpenGL-ES
- Android opengl shader program to copy image from camera to SSBO for TF-lite GPU Inference
- read-only storage buffer in OpenGL ES and Spir-V
- UnsupportedOperationException when calling GLES32 glGetDebugMessageLog
- Open GL ES local and global workgroup size relations
- Open GL ES error: undefined reference to 'glDispatchCompute'
Popular Questions
- How do I undo the most recent local commits in Git?
- How can I remove a specific item from an array in JavaScript?
- How do I delete a Git branch locally and remotely?
- Find all files containing a specific text (string) on Linux?
- How do I revert a Git repository to a previous commit?
- How do I create an HTML button that acts like a link?
- How do I check out a remote Git branch?
- How do I force "git pull" to overwrite local files?
- How do I list all files of a directory?
- How to check whether a string contains a substring in JavaScript?
- How do I redirect to another webpage?
- How can I iterate over rows in a Pandas DataFrame?
- How do I convert a String to an int in Java?
- Does Python have a string 'contains' substring method?
- How do I check if a string contains a specific word?
Trending Questions
- UIImageView Frame Doesn't Reflect Constraints
- Is it possible to use adb commands to click on a view by finding its ID?
- How to create a new web character symbol recognizable by html/javascript?
- Why isn't my CSS3 animation smooth in Google Chrome (but very smooth on other browsers)?
- Heap Gives Page Fault
- Connect ffmpeg to Visual Studio 2008
- Both Object- and ValueAnimator jumps when Duration is set above API LvL 24
- How to avoid default initialization of objects in std::vector?
- second argument of the command line arguments in a format other than char** argv or char* argv[]
- How to improve efficiency of algorithm which generates next lexicographic permutation?
- Navigating to the another actvity app getting crash in android
- How to read the particular message format in android and store in sqlite database?
- Resetting inventory status after order is cancelled
- Efficiently compute powers of X in SSE/AVX
- Insert into an external database using ajax and php : POST 500 (Internal Server Error)
You cannot bind any of the native window surface attachments as textures; it's simply not possible in the API.